Zurich Financial Services Group (Zurich), a provider of insurance-based financial services, has appointed Debra Broek, current CFO of Global Life, as deputy head of investor relations, effective from April 1, 2010, to support the head of investor relations in interfacing with investor community and rating agencies.

In her new role, Ms Broek will report to Malcolm Gilbert, head of investor relations and will be located in Zurich, Switzerland. She joined Zurich in 2007 as CFO of Global Life. Prior to this, she was chief accounting officer for Winterthur Group.

Joachim Masur, current group controller, has been named as the new CFO of Global Life for leading the Global Life finance team to support the delivery of its strategic aspirations. He will report to Mario Greco, CEO of Global Life, and will be located in Zurich, Switzerland.

Mr Masur joined Zurich in 2005 as group controller. Prior to this he was a partner with financial services practice of KPMG in Germany.

Scott Egan, current group head of operations, planning and performance management, has been named as the new group controller. In his new role, he will bring together the group controller team with his existing group planning and performance management responsibilities. He will report to Dieter Wemmer, CFO of Zurich, and will be located in Zurich, Switzerland.

Mr Egan joined Zurich in late 2007 as CFO for UK General Insurance. Previously he held a number of senior finance and non finance positions at Aviva.
